Galmed & Tissue Dynamics Unveil Cardiac Fibrosis Pathway; Aramchol Reduces Fibrosis 4-Fold

AI Summary

Galmed Pharmaceuticals and Tissue Dynamics announced preclinical study results revealing a previously unknown metabolic pathway for cardiac fibrosis and heart failure. The study demonstrated that a combination of Galmed's Aramchol Meglumine and a selective PPARα agonist reduced fibrotic burden by approximately fourfold in human cardiac organoids, while preserving cardiac muscle integrity. This discovery supports the development of Aramchol for cardiac fibrosis, with a new patent application filed and preparations for IND-enabling activities underway. The collaboration aims to expand therapeutic opportunities for fibrotic diseases.
